A U.S. Navy sailor was medically evacuated from the aircraft carrier USS Abraham Lincoln (CVN-72) following an injury sustained during flight operations. The incident occurred while the carrier was operating in the Pacific Ocean, highlighting the inherent risks associated with maintaining readiness in a dynamic maritime environment. The sailor was transported to a medical facility ashore for further treatment and evaluation, with the Navy confirming the individual is in stable condition. While specific details of the injury have not been released, such events underscore the critical importance of safety protocols and immediate medical response capabilities aboard naval vessels.

The USS Abraham Lincoln, a Nimitz-class aircraft carrier, is a powerful symbol of U.S. naval presence and power projection. Carriers are complex, fast-paced operational environments where thousands of personnel work in close proximity to high-energy machinery and aircraft. Flight operations, in particular, demand extreme precision and adherence to safety standards, as the deck of an aircraft carrier is one of the most hazardous workplaces in the world. Injuries, though hopefully rare, can occur, and the ability to provide rapid medical care and evacuation is paramount to crew welfare and operational continuity.
